HB 3, “Taxation; to exempt certain retail sales of fish or other seafood from sales and use taxes”, was introduced in the House on Jun 25, 2025 by Rep. Chip Brown (R). It last saw action on Apr 7, 2026: Read for the Second Time and placed on the Calendar.

A BILL
TO BE ENTITLED
AN ACT
Relating to taxation; to provide an exemption from the
state sales and use tax for certain retail sales of fish or
other seafood; and to provide for counties and municipalities
to exempt these sales from local sales and use taxes.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F ALABAMA:
Section 1. (a) (1) The gross proceeds from the retail
sale of fish or other seafood which is in its original or
unmanufactured state by a producer are exempt from the state
sales and use tax as provided for in Section 40-23-2 and
40-23-61, Code of Alabama 1975.
(2) For the purposes of this section, "producer" shall
mean a licensed commercial fisherman or an owner of a
commercially licensed vessel that is also licensed pursuant to
Section 9-12-125, Code of Alabama 1975 to sell seafood to the
public.
(b) Any county or municipality may exempt the gross
proceeds from the retail sale of fish or seafood which is in
its original or unmanufactured state by a producer from county
or municipal sales and use taxes in accordance with Section
40-23-4.01, Code of Alabama 1975.
Page 1
HB3 Engrossed
Section 2. This act shall become effective on September
1, 2026.
